HB101 High Temperature Shift Catalyst
Application
HB101 catalysts are used to promote the conversion of CO with steam into H2 and CO in ammonia plants or hydrogen production units. CB125 catalysts are used in both radial and axial/radial high temperature shift converters.
Characteristics
HB101 catalysts are the first impregnated high temperature shift catalysts in China. They have the advantages of better activity at low temperature and lower steam/gas ratio, higher mechanical strength in the reduced state than in the oxidized state and lower sulfur content.
